Преобразование строки со словами Unicode - PullRequest
0 голосов
/ 19 февраля 2012

У меня есть строка, содержащая Unicode words . например:

String uniString = "that is an example \u05e9\u05dc\u05d5\u05dd the end.";

Итак, мой вопрос к вам, как я могу преобразовать эту строку в строку, где слова в кодировке Юникод преобразуются в одиночный символ.

Примечание. Я получаю запрос от сервера.

Спасибо за голову.

1 Ответ

0 голосов
/ 19 февраля 2012

native2ascii - это то, что вы ищете:

http://docs.oracle.com/javase/1.4.2/docs/tooldocs/windows/native2ascii.html

Просто сделайте это, чтобы преобразовать экранирование Unicode в ваш исходный файл:

native2ascii -reverse -encoding UTF-8 src/Foo.java transformed/Foo.java
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...